WebA compost tumbler is a fully sealed container which can be rotated to mix the composting materials. The sealed container also helps contain the heat generated by the composting process, thereby speeding the process of converting kitchen and yard waste into compost. ... WebTo keep the process going at its fastest clip, the tumbler is turned twice or three times a week, mixing the microbes with the organic material while infusing fresh supplies of oxygen. The tumbler keeps the materials … darksiders main characterWebOct 10, 2024 · The compost tumbler is the most effective enclosed bin method of composting waste. This is because, with the compost tumbler, it’s possible to maintain the optimum temperatures in the tumbler. In this case, the tumbler acts as a great insulator and the constant turning of the compost keeps the microbes in there well aerated and fully … bishop sheard funeralWebWith the compost bin you might need to wait for a few months until the compost is ready. Ready compost is dark brown or black with a nice earthy smell.
